Can a diabetic female conceive?

Q: I am a juvenile diabetic girl since the last 5 years and I am on insulin since then. My parents too are diabetic. My question is whether there is any problem in conceiving under such conditions? My doctors are of different opinions and are not giving even 60 percent chances of safe delivery and the after effects on the child. Can you guide me about this problem? I am very much interested in having child of my own.

A:Diabetic women can certainly have children of their own, but you have to be very tightly controlled right from the period when you are trying to conceive till the end of pregnancy. That means that throughout this period you will need 3-6 blood tests daily, and adjusting insulin doses accordingly, so that you remain in the 80-120 mg/dl range as far as possible.
